Intel Stock Falls Amid Skepticism Over Potential Deals

Intel stock plunged 6% Wednesday after analysts expressed skepticism over reports of potential deals with TSMC and Broadcom. Intel shares surged 16% Tuesday on news TSMC was considering controlling some or all of Intel's semiconductor factories. However, analysts say a TSMC-Intel deal could face regulatory scrutiny, and it wouldn't make sense for TSMC to take control of Intel's manufacturing facilities due to separate manufacturing processes.
